Output 052b3a24fa92a99cc3f57776a8061debd3ae01aef7321b551c2321c69a4287e5:1

value
40109974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2bfc76dab686a71655ba12ef24ff3d597c2a940 OP_EQUAL
address
3KSkkoGefhnUaMSuR6awpaX3zMzgCyQjEU
transaction
052b3a24fa92a99cc3f57776a8061debd3ae01aef7321b551c2321c69a4287e5
spent
true